Output de67569b0301f33f500d830692487a8f5b6f42a65b9451574f27288dc558ac9e:0

value
184529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7d3143a8c1ee5c58baddcafafe1c28602e469d OP_EQUAL
address
3Cwy1fMKGU3uaaVgmCrT4mpKWfUwuWcMaS
transaction
de67569b0301f33f500d830692487a8f5b6f42a65b9451574f27288dc558ac9e
spent
true